Computer "Disc" message

Post by daharleyrdr »

Sorry I believe this has been discussed before could'nt find it in search? On my 2000 V70XC Im getting the "Disc" message on the computer screen on the dash I believe it was said to switch the knob for the copmputer next to the reset button. This only works temporarily then it comes back? Any help? what does this mean? thanks Bill

It means "DISConnected" Your instrument cluster is not communicating with the ECU (main computer).

The DISC message you see in the trip computer display is indicative of the trip computer or INFO switch contacts being dirty or not making full contact. I had this issue when I had to desolder and reassemble the switch's circuit board to replace the lamp inside. In my case it was not making full contact.

You can operate the switch repeatedly to try to clean the contacts or replace the switch or even just live with the DISC message.
